Irresistible Holiday Berry Meringue Wreath Recipe Perfect for Celebrations


  • Author: Nora Winslow
  • Total Time: 2 hours 50 minutes
  • Yield: 8 servings 1x

Description

A stunning holiday dessert featuring a wreath-shaped meringue topped with fresh berries and vibrant pomegranate sauce. Light, airy, and perfect for celebrations.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 large egg whites, room temperature
  • 1 cup granulated sugar (200g)
  • 1 teaspoon cornstarch (5g)
  • 1 teaspoon white vinegar (5ml)
  • 1½ cups mixed fresh berries (225g, raspberries, blueberries, sliced strawberries)
  • ½ cup pomegranate seeds (75g)
  • ½ cup pomegranate juice (120ml)
  • 2 tablespoons honey (30ml)
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ice (15ml)
  • Powdered sugar for dusting (optional)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 275°F (135°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Draw a 10-inch circle on the paper as a guide.
  2. In a clean mixing bowl, beat the egg whites on medium speed until soft peaks form, about 2-3 minutes. Gradually add the sugar, 1 tablespoon at a time, beating well after each addition. Increase to high speed and beat until stiff peaks form.
  3. Sift the cornstarch over the meringue and gently fold it in along with the vinegar. Fold until combined without overmixing.
  4. Spoon the meringue onto the parchment circle, creating a ring shape. Use the back of a spoon to make swirls and peaks.
  5. Bake the meringue for 90 minutes. Turn off the oven and let it cool inside for at least 2 hours.
  6. Combine pomegranate juice, honey, and lemon juice in a saucepan. Simmer over medium heat until slightly thickened, about 5-7 minutes. Let it cool completely.
  7. Transfer the cooled meringue to a serving platter. Top with fresh berries, pomegranate seeds, and a drizzle of sauce. Dust with powdered sugar for a snowy finish.

Notes

Ensure all tools are grease-free for perfect meringue. Add toppings just before serving to keep the meringue crisp. If cracks occur, call it rustic and enjoy!
